Output 354077a3b605276dc3c30df6c6d73f4d1a62089a8f484465b3f8b77bce5b96f1:6

value
2421535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d7aae0fc13c0f02d5e6e52fb6b55f1d7636ca2b OP_EQUAL
address
3D8VMUQi6HREcCVSvCB1hSXsLZPiNRhHWg
transaction
354077a3b605276dc3c30df6c6d73f4d1a62089a8f484465b3f8b77bce5b96f1
spent
true